1. why do these sausages have a lower protein content than chickpeas? 2. if i see the protein content as a daily ration, 28% per 100 g, i would have to eat 8 sausages a day, which corresponds to 400 g. is that correct?
Hello PatJ, the M-Classic Wienerli have a protein content of 14g per 100g, cooked chickpeas contain approx. 7g protein per 100g (you cannot compare this with dried chickpeas). The percentages provide information on what the consumption of one portion of the product means for covering the daily requirement of protein, for example. Reference values for the daily intake, so-called "reference amounts", are used, which are based on a diet of 2000 calories (equivalent to 8400 kilojoules), which corresponds to the requirements of an average adult. The daily requirement can of course be lower or higher, depending on age, gender, physical activity, etc. The daily protein requirement should of course be covered by various foods - and not only by Wienerli.
